About Pennsville

Pennsville is a township in Salem County, New Jersey, designated as the westernmost municipality in the state along the Delaware River. Named for William Penn, the community of approximately 12,200 is part of the South Jersey and greater Philadelphia region. Public education is administered by the Pennsville Township School District, with students attending Pennsville Memorial High School.
